The new Arsenal winger Lukas Podolski has been extremely impressive in the opening games of this season as the Gunners have remained unbeaten in all competitions, but the German international has declared that it is far too early for him to be declared a star for the Gunners after just a few games into his first season.

Podolski, 27, said: “You come to a new club and a new league and you never know how it will start or how the team plays.

“The style of football is the kind I like. One or two touches. Quick passing. Fast at the front.

Arsenal only managed to win 1-0 over Everton this weekend and it was thanks to the usual Van Persie winning goal, but the Dutchman was not happy with his own performance and thought that his finish was just lucky!

He said: “It wasn’t a great game in my opinion, especially from myself as too often I had touches which did not go the way I wanted,”

“I’m not really happy with that, with my own performance, but pleased with the win.”

“It was a great pass again from Alex Song, unbelievable. He is a defensive midfielder, but the amount of skill he has is just a dream. A great pass from him.

There have been some really strange Arsenal transfer rumours this week, but this must surely stand out as the most unlikely. The Star reckons that Arsene Wenger is targeting Tottenham’s Jermain Defoe to replace Nicklas Bendtner.

Defoe has had anawful season at Spurs. He’s either been injured, out-of-form or just plain whinging all year at White Hart Lane, and when given a chance to prove himself again he has gone missing completely.

Harry Redknapp would love to get £10m from anyone for the 29 year-old prima donna so he can buy a proper striker, so why on earth would Arsenal even consider him, even if he didn’t play for the Spuds!
